titleOfInvention Agent for biological degradation of petroleum oil pollution.
abstract The invention relates to a method and a composition for the biological degradation of oil pollution in solid substrates, such as soil, earth, solid waste deposits, etc.. It is characterized in that a fertilizer composition is applied to the substrate in situ which preferably comprises a mixture of the following composition:n (A) ≧ 10 mass-% of an organicfertilizer, (B) ≧ 10 mass-% of a natural substance improving the structure and physical properties of the mixture, (C) ≦ 5 mass-% of a multicomponent fertilizer, (D) ≦ 5 mass-% of a fertilizer comprising trace elements, and (E) ≦ 2 mass-% of an ammonium or ammine salt, and eventually (F) ≦ 10 mass-% of one or more mineral admixtures, and eventually (G) ≦ 5 mass-% of biocompost, (H) the remainder of up to 100 mass-% consisting of biologically active waste sludge containing oil substances and/or waste from the exploitation and processing of oil and products thereof. n The composition is capable of effectively degrading oil substances in original environment. Apart from the degradation of oil substances, it simultaneously improves the soil properties and optimizes the contents of organic matter and mineral nutrients.
